This print showcases the intricate details of the Os Meninos da Graca statues, which gracefully support a terrestrial globe outside the Igreja da Graca in Evora, Portugal. As a UNESCO World Heritage Site, this 16th-century church stands as a testament to Portugal's rich architectural heritage and historical significance. The statues themselves exude strength and balance, symbolizing their role in upholding this monumental structure.
